The region’s terrain features a varied mix of smooth pavement, packed dirt, and rocky lanes winding through oak and beech forests, farmland, and traditional Basque farmhouses. The gravel routes provide a fresh cycling alternative that avoids urban congestion while revealing the natural biodiversity hidden in the foothills. These quieter roads are home to local wildlife such as hawks and wild boars, and travelers can expect to encounter impressive geological formations including limestone outcrops and coastal cliffs shaped by Atlantic winds.
Basque culture permeates the area with its rich history dating back centuries, embodied in distinctive Basque architecture and small villages where Euskara, the Basque language, is spoken alongside Spanish. Adjust tire pressure to balance grip and comfort on mixed gravel and pavement surfaces.
Bring basic tools and a spare tube since gravel routes can mean sharp rocks and unexpected flats.
Though trails offer stunning views, water sources can be scarce, so carry enough fluids for your ride.
Coastal Basque weather shifts quickly—wind and rain can affect trail conditions and visibility.
San Sebastián’s coastal paths connect villages important in Basque maritime trade dating back to medieval times.
Local efforts focus on balancing cycling tourism with protecting native flora and fragile coastal ecosystems.
